BUSINESS UNIT

Filtration & Separation

Graver Technologies, with decades of expertise in filtration solutions, offers a broad range of high-performance and cost-effective filter cartridges and housings. Serving industries such as food and beverage, chemicals, microelectronics, and healthcare, we provide liquid process filters in various formats, including melt blown depth filters, resin bonded filters, microfiberglass and polypropylene pleated cartridges, and membrane filters with PTFE or PES membranes. Our solutions are designed for durability and efficiency, ensuring you have the right filtration system for even the most demanding applications.

Cross Flow Membranes

Scepter Membrane products from Graver facilitate filtration in demanding environments through cross-flow membranes that handle high temperatures, aggressive chemistries, and high-viscosity fluids. These membranes are particularly suitable for heavy solids applications without the risk of clogging.

AGS™ Series Compressed Air & Gas Filters
Industrial Air & Gas Filters & Systems

AGS™ Series Compressed Air & Gas Filters

The AGS Series coalescing filters effectively separate oil, water, and other liquid aerosols from compressed air and gas lines.

Key features:
  • ASME Code design and constructed
  • High flow rate capability
  • Low pressure drop & long element life
  • High temperature capability
  • Economical replaceable cartridges
  • Modified and custom designs available
  • Design pressures from 180 psi to 1440 psi
  • Contact Factory for higher pressure applications

Citadel® Series
Liquid Filters

Citadel® Series

Citadel pleated membrane cartridges feature a PTFE membrane and PFA structural components to provide excellent chemical and temperature resistance for aggressive chemical applications such as etchers, strippers, cleaners and bulk chemicals.

Key features:
  • Manufactured, flushed, tested and packagedin an ISO Class 7 Cleanroom Environment
  • Filters are flushed with 18 MΩ-cm DI water toensure low extractables and low particle shedding
  • 100% integrity tested to provide reliable performance
  • Resistivity rinse-up to 18 MΩ-cm and single digitppb TOC levels with minimal throughput
  • Pore size ratings from 0.05 to 10 micronto meet a broad range of applications
  • Wet-Pack option available to eliminate the requirementfor solvent pre-wetting in aqueous applications
